Tonight: Eurovision Song Contest 2009

After two semi finals, the grand final of the 2009 Eurovision Song Contest will be held tonight. 25 countries compete to win and host the 55th edition of the contest next year.

The programme

The show will start at 21:00 CET and it will be hosted by Alsou and Ivan Urgant at the Olympic Indoor Arena in Moscow. The final will be opened by a performance of the Terem Quartet, the Cirque du soleil and 2008 Eurovision Song Contest winner Dima Bilan with his winning entry Believe. The interval act will be performed by Fuerza Bruta.

The voting

25 countries will present one song each. Every country will give 1-8, 10 and 12 to their ten favourite entries of the other countries. The ranking will be based on 50% televoting and 50% jury voting. In the case of a tie, the country that got points from more different countries gets the higher position. If there is still a tie, the higher position goes to the country that received the higher amount of 12 points (or 10 points, 8 points and so on). From this year onwards, it is clearly stated that this rule shall be used to dissolve any tie, not just a tie that affects the winner. Apart from the 25 finalists, the 17 countries that were eliminated in the semi finals will also have voting rights.

The line-up

(Composer/lyricist in brackets)

  1. Lithuania - Sasha Son - Love
    (Sasha Son)
  2. Israel - Noa & Mira Awad - There must be another way
    (Noa, Mira Awad, Gil Dor)
  3. France - Patricia Kaas - Et s'il fallait le faire
    (Anse Lazio/Fred Blondin)
  4. Sweden - Malena Ernman - La voix
    (Fredrik Kempe/Fredrik Kempe, Malena Ernman)
  5. Croatia - Igor Cukrov feat. Andrea - Lijepa Tena
    (Tonci Huljic/Vjekoslava Huljic)
  6. Portugal - Flor-de-Lis - Todas as ruas do amor
    (Pedro Marques/Pedro Marques, Paulo Pereira)
  7. Iceland - Yohanna - Is it true?
    (Tinatin Japaridze, Óskar Páll Sveinsson, Chris Neil)
  8. Greece - Sakis Rouvas - This is our night
    (Dimitris Kontopoulos/Craig Porteils, Cameron Giles-Webb)
  9. Armenia - Inga & Anush - Nor par
    (Mane Akopyan/Avet Barseghyan, Vardan Zadoyan)
  10. Russia - Anastasiya Pridhodko - Mamo
    (Konstantin Meladze/Konstantin Meladze, Diana Golde)
  11. Azerbaijan - AySel & Arash - Always
    (R. Uhlmann, A. Labaf, A. Papakonstantinou, M. Englöf, J. Bejerholm, A. Wrethov, E. Wrethov)
  12. Bosnia & Herzegovina - Regina - Bistra voda
    (Aleksandar Covic)
  13. Moldova - Nelly Ciobanu - Hora din Moldova
    (Veaceslav Daniliuc/Nelly Ciobanu, Andrei Hadjiu, Aristotelis Kalimeris)
  14. Malta - Chiara - What if we?
    (Marc Paelinck/Gregory Bilsen)
  15. Estonia - Urban Symphony - Rändajad
    (Sven Lõhmus)
  16. Denmark - Brinck - Believe again
    (Lars Halvor Jensen, Martin Larsson, Ronan Keating)
  17. Germany - Alex Swings! Oscar Sings! - Miss kiss kiss bang
    (Alex Christensen)
  18. Turkey - Hadise - Düm tek tek
    (Sinan Akçil/Hadise, Sinan Akçil, Stefan Fernande)
  19. Albania - Kejsi Tola - Carry me in your dreams
    (Edmond Zhulali/Agim Doçi, June Muftaraj Taylor)
  20. Norway - Alexander Rybak - Fairytale
    (Alexander Rybak)
  21. Ukraine - Svetlana Lobody - Be my Valentine! (Anti-crisis girl)
    (Svetlana Loboda/Yevgeny Matyushenko)
  22. Romania - Elena Georghe - The Balkan girls
    (Daris Mangal, Ovidiu Bistriceanu, Laurentiu Duta/Laurentiu Duta, Alexandru Pelin)
  23. United Kingdom - Jade Ewen - It's my time
    (Diane Warren, Andrew Lloyd Webber)
  24. Finland - Waldo's People - Lose control
    (Karima, Ari Erik Veikko Lehtonen/Karima, Annie Kratz-Gutå, Ari Erik Veikko Lehtonen, Waldo)
  25. Spain - Soraya - La noche es para mí
    (Irini Michas, Dimitri Stassos, Jason Gill/Felipe Pedroso)
